Why Moving in Richmond Needs Local Experience

Moving in Richmond is different from moving in a quiet outer suburb. The distance might be short, but the access can be tricky. A move from an apartment near Victoria Street, a terrace close to Bridge Road or an office near Church Street can take longer than expected if the movers have not planned the job properly.

Tight Streets, Tram Lines and Busy Access Points

One thing to always consider with Richmond moves is where the truck can actually stop. A moving truck parked too far from the entrance can add time, effort and cost. On busy streets, even a small access issue can slow the whole move down.

That is why good local removalists in Richmond Melbourne will usually ask about parking, stairs, lifts, loading zones and building rules before the move. This is not just admin — it helps avoid surprises on moving day.

For apartments, lift bookings are especially important. Many buildings require you to reserve the lift in advance, protect common areas and move within approved hours. For terrace homes, the challenge is often narrow hallways, steep stairs or awkward furniture angles. In both cases, experienced movers know how to protect your items and work around the property without rushing.

Apartments, Terrace Houses and Office Moves

Richmond has a mix of old and new properties, and that affects the move. A modern apartment may have a loading bay but strict lift rules. A Victorian terrace may have charm but almost no room to manoeuvre a large couch. An office move may need to happen outside trading hours to avoid disruption.

When helping people organise Richmond moves, the best results usually come from asking the right questions early: How many stairs? Is there a lift? Can the truck park outside? Are there heavy items? Is anything fragile, oversized or difficult to dismantle?

Those details help match the right moving team to the job, instead of guessing on the day.

How Much Do Removalists Cost in Richmond?

The cost of removalists in Richmond depends on your move size, access and timing. Some companies promote hourly rates, while others offer fixed or tailored quotes. For Richmond Melbourne, the final price depends on the real details of the job.

Move Type Typical Estimate
Studio or small move$250 – $600
1 bedroom apartment$350 – $700
2 bedroom apartment or home$550 – $950
3 bedroom house$800 – $1,400
4+ bedroom home$1,200 – $2,200+
Office or commercial moveFrom around $600

⚠️ These are estimates only. The exact price depends on your property, access, distance and what services you need. A small apartment with lift access and easy parking may be straightforward. The same apartment with stairs, no loading bay and a long carry takes longer and costs more. Always get a written quote.

What Affects the Price of a Richmond Move?

The biggest cost factors are usually:

  • Number of bedrooms or total item volume
  • Number of movers needed
  • Travel time
  • Stairs, lifts or difficult access
  • Parking distance from the property
  • Heavy items such as pianos, safes or marble tables
  • Packing and unpacking
  • Urgency or same-day booking
  • Time of week or season

A small apartment move with easy lift access will usually be faster than a terrace house move with stairs and poor parking. This is why the cheapest hourly rate is not always the cheapest final move.

Hourly Rates vs Fixed Moving Quotes

Hourly rates can be good for simple local moves, especially when access is easy and the inventory is clear. Fixed quotes can be useful when you want more certainty.

The key is transparency. Before booking, ask what is included, what could cost extra and whether there are call-out fees, depot-to-depot charges, fuel charges, stair fees or after-hours fees. Clear quotes protect both sides — the mover knows what they are walking into, and you know what to expect.

Tips for a Smooth Move in Richmond

A little preparation can save a lot of time on moving day.

Book Lift Access Early

If you are moving in or out of an apartment, book the lift as early as possible. Ask the building manager about moving hours, padding requirements and loading dock rules.

Plan Truck Parking Before Moving Day

Parking can make or break a Richmond move. If the truck has to park too far away, movers spend more time carrying items and the move may cost more. Check available loading zones or apply for a parking permit if needed.

Pack Fragile Items Properly

Use strong boxes, label fragile items clearly and avoid overpacking. Heavy boxes are harder to move and more likely to break. Packing in advance also means movers can focus on moving, not waiting.

Choose the Right Truck Size for Narrow Streets

A bigger truck is not always better in Richmond. Sometimes the best option is the truck that can actually access the property safely. Ask your removalist about truck sizing before booking.
